Repair of the Dyulino Pass: New Deadlines and Challenges

The long-awaited repair of the Dyulino Pass, which has been ongoing for years, finally has a specific deadline. Minister of Regional Development Ivan Shishkov announced during parliamentary control that the project will be fully completed by mid-2027.

"The projected deadline for the quality completion of the repair is mid-2027. The road might be functional for the next tourist season," Shishkov stated.

Problems for local residents

The closed route creates serious difficulties for access to the Nessebar villages of Koznitsa and Panitsovo. Residents face dangerous excavated streets and potholes in front of their homes. Currently, traffic is being directed via the detour route Burgas – Varna, through Obzor.
